Protector App Offers On-Demand Armed Security in NYC and LA
The app, dubbed 'Uber with guns,' allows users to hire armed bodyguards and motorcades, with plans for expansion and a sister neighborhood security service on the way.
- Protector is a mobile app that lets users hire armed bodyguards and drivers, featuring customizable uniforms and motorcades of black SUVs.
- The service, currently available in New York City and Los Angeles, charges a minimum of $629 for five hours of protection and requires a $129 annual membership fee.
- Protector's popularity surged after TikTok influencers showcased the service in viral videos, boosting its ranking in the Apple App Store's Travel category.
- The app was launched ahead of schedule following the murder of UnitedHealthcare CEO Brian Thompson, with its founder citing the incident as an example of the need for accessible private security.
- Protector's sister app, Patrol, set to launch soon, will allow neighborhoods to crowdfund private security, offering features like drones and connected cameras based on funding levels.
